The story of Betty J White began in 1937 in WV. In 1935, Betty J White established residence. In 1940, Betty J White resided in Dry Fork, Randolph, West Virginia, USA. Betty J White married Raymond E Bartlett, and had children including Beverly A Stilts, Eugene R Bartlett, Jeffery W Bartlett, Thomas L Bartlett. Betty J White passed away in 2012 in Cranberry Township, Butler County, Pennsylvania, United States of America.
